🔶 Origin and Cultural Significance
Tater tot casseroles, also known as “hotdish” in the Midwest U.S., originated as a practical and comforting way to combine pantry staples into a single dish. This BBQ-loaded version puts a modern, Southern-inspired twist on the classic with smoky meat, bacon, and sweet-savory BBQ sauce—a flavor profile loved across American cookouts and diners alike.
🔶 Ingredients Quantity 🛒
- 32 oz frozen tater tots
- 1 lb ground beef or turkey
- 1 cup BBQ sauce (your favorite style)
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 6 slices bacon, cooked and crumbled
- 1/2 small red onion, diced (optional)
- 1/2 tsp garlic powder
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Fresh chives or green onions, for garnish (optional)

🔶 Tips for Success
- Pre-cook bacon until crispy for the best crunch and flavor.
- Use high-quality BBQ sauce that balances sweet and smoky flavors.
- Brown the meat well to build flavor—don’t rush it.
- Bake uncovered to let the tots crisp up perfectly.
- Let the casserole sit for 5–10 minutes after baking for clean slices.
🔶 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
- In a skillet, cook ground beef or turkey over medium heat until browned. Drain excess fat.
- Stir in BBQ sauce, garlic powder, diced onion (if using), and season with salt and pepper. Simmer for 2–3 minutes.
- In a 9×13-inch baking dish, spread the BBQ meat mixture evenly.
- Sprinkle half the cheese over the meat layer, followed by half the crumbled bacon.
- Arrange tater tots in a single layer over the top.
- Bake uncovered for 25–30 minutes, or until tots are golden and crispy.
- Remove from oven, sprinkle remaining cheese and bacon over the top, and bake for another 5–7 minutes until cheese is melted.
- Garnish with green onions or chives and serve hot.

🔶 Nutritional Information (Per Serving, Approx. 1/6 of casserole)
- Calories: 540
- Protein: 25g
- Fat: 35g
- Saturated Fat: 12g
- Carbohydrates: 30g
- Sugar: 8g
- Sodium: 780mg
- Fiber: 2g
